Obverse description A winged allegorical figure of Victory stands in high relief at centre, her outstretched arms connecting two oval medallions: at left, the laureate bust of Leopold I, King of the Belgians, facing right, with the legend 'LEOPOLD I ROI DES BELGES'; at right, the laureate bust of Louis-Philippe I, King of the French, facing left, with the legend 'LOUIS PHILIPPE I ROI DES FRANÇAIS'. Below, a stylised locomotive in the exergue bears the motto 'L'UNION FAIT LA FORCE'. The engraver's signature 'HART FECIT' appears in the lower field.
